Layui和jQuery是兩種常用的前端框架,它們各自擁有優點和特點。在項目開發中,有時會遇到需要同時使用這兩種框架的情況。本文將探討Layui和jQuery在項目中的融合應用,并通過具體的代碼示例,展示它們如何配合使用。
一、Layui和jQuery的特點和優勢
-
Layui是一款輕量級的前端UI框架,它提供了豐富的UI組件和模塊化的開發方式,使得前端開發變得更加簡單和高效。Layui的設計思想是簡潔、易用,適合快速開發各種Web應用。
jQuery是一個優秀的JavaScript庫,它簡化了DOM操作、事件處理、動畫效果等操作,使得前端開發變得更加方便和便捷。jQuery的最大優勢是兼容性強,支持各種瀏覽器,簡化了前端開發的復雜性。
二、Layui和jQuery的融合應用
在實際項目開發中,往往需要在使用Layui的基礎上,結合jQuery來完成一些特殊的功能需求。下面通過一個具體的案例來展示Layui和jQuery的融合應用。
案例:實現一個點擊按鈕彈出對話框的功能
- 首先,我們引入Layui和jQuery的相關資源文件到HTML中。
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Layui和jQuery融合應用</title> <link rel="stylesheet" href="layui/css/layui.css"> <script src="jquery.min.js"></script> <script src="layui/layui.js"></script> </head> <body> <button id="btn">點擊彈出對話框</button> </body> </html>
登錄后復制
- 接著,編寫JavaScript代碼,通過jQuery和Layui配合實現按鈕點擊彈出對話框的功能。
$(document).ready(function(){ layui.use('layer', function(){ var layer = layui.layer; $('#btn').click(function(){ layer.open({ title: '提示', content: '這是一個彈出對話框示例', btn: ['確定', '取消'], yes: function(index, layero){ layer.close(index); }, btn2: function(index, layero){ // 取消按鈕的回調函數 } }); }); }); });
登錄后復制
通過以上代碼示例,我們成功地將Layui的彈出對話框功能與jQuery的事件綁定方法結合起來,實現了點擊按鈕彈出對話框的功能。
三、總結
本文探討了Layui和jQuery在項目中的融合應用,通過一個具體的案例展示了它們如何配合使用。在實際項目開發中,可以根據需求靈活選擇使用Layui和jQuery的功能,充分發揮它們各自的優勢,提高前端開發效率和用戶體驗。希望本文能對讀者有所幫助,謝謝閱讀!